Arig's 'Workshop on Reinsurance' concludes

Arab Insurance Group (Arig) concluded its 'Workshop on Reinsurance', here today.

The five-day workshop which commenced at Arig House on 10th September covered the principles and practices in the reinsurance industry. Senior Managers from Arig presented on topics covering Reinsurance theory and practice, Underwriting, Risk Management, Claims and Accounting. Eleven participants representing the regional markets like the UAE, Saudi Arabia, Jordan, Ethiopia and Pakistan besides Bahrain's market attended the workshop.

Currently, the region's (re)insurance sector is witnessing dynamic growth. Availability of skilled and trained human resources is therefore a key requirement for the industry's success. Arig with its business expertise of over 25 years has been playing a lead role in providing essential training to young professionals who aspire to build their career in (re)insurance industry by organizing such workshops and seminars.

Understanding the technical aspect of reinsurance business is a complex task. Therefore, Arig firmly believes in sharing its business expertise with its clients by fostering professional training to their key employees who play a major role in their organization. Arig is confident that such workshops will go a long way in shaping the young generation as managers for tomorrow in the (re)insurance industry.
